Searched refs:p_stack (Results 1 – 3 of 3) sorted by relevance
50 while (ps.p_stack[ps.tos] == ifhead && tk != elselit) { in parse()52 ps.p_stack[ps.tos] = stmt; /* apply the if(..) stmt ::= stmt in parse()64 if (ps.p_stack[ps.tos] != decl) { /* only put one declaration in parse()68 ps.p_stack[++ps.tos] = decl; in parse()75 if (ps.p_stack[i] == decl) in parse()84 if (ps.p_stack[ps.tos] == elsehead && ps.else_if) /* "else if ..." */ in parse()88 ps.p_stack[++ps.tos] = tk; in parse()96 if (ps.p_stack[ps.tos] == stmt || ps.p_stack[ps.tos] == decl in parse()97 || ps.p_stack[ps.tos] == stmtl) in parse()109 if (ps.p_stack[ps.tos] == swstmt && ps.case_indent >= 1) in parse()[all …]
226 int p_stack[STACKSIZE]; /* this is the parsers stack */ member
214 ps.p_stack[0] = stmt; /* this is the parser's stack */ in main()915 if (ps.p_stack[ps.tos] == decl && !ps.block_init) /* semicolons can be in main()944 ps.search_brace = cuddle_else && ps.p_stack[ps.tos] == ifhead in main()